Open Review PR
This skill keeps its historical file/name for compatibility, but fallow PRs are
ready for review by default. Do not open draft PRs unless the user explicitly
asks for a draft.
Workflow:
- Review the changed files and confirm the scope.
- Run the smallest relevant validation for the touched area.
- Prepare a concise conventional commit message.
- Commit with signing if committing is requested.
- Push the branch. GitHub refuses a PR for a branch with no commits; make an
intentional empty coordination commit before the first push when the
branch is fresh.
- Open a ready PR with a high-signal conventional title and body.
Requirements:
- Use conventional commits.
- Use signed commits.
- Use a descriptive non-
codex/ branch name, for example feat/<slug>,
fix/<slug>, refactor/<slug>, docs/<slug>, or chore/<slug>.
- Do not pass
--draft to gh pr create unless the user explicitly asks for a draft.
- Do not add AI attribution.
- Summarize validation honestly if some checks were not run.
